Then you may have just found your perfect job… We’re Craft Gin Club - a Sunday Times Fast Track 100 UK startup and the world’s biggest gin subscription service. Ever since our founders pitched successfully on Dragons’ Den, we’ve been hard at work, scouting the country - and the globe! - to find the world's finest small-batch gins. Every month, we send thousands of gin lovers across the country a surprise box packed with craft gins, perfectly paired mixers, foodie treats and our club mag. Our community of club members is at the heart of what we do, and this role offers the opportunity to play a key role in delivering a first-class customer experience. We are looking for someone who is available to work Monday to Friday and on weekends. Specific days and times required potentially varying month to month based on business needs. Key Responsibilities

Helping to maintain high levels of customer satisfaction Responding to inbound customer enquiries via email and live chat on our help desk software, answering questions and resolving problems Helping with some maintenance of social media channels Assisting with upcoming projects of providing a more proactive outbound customer service via phone and email Maintaining regular administrative tasks Assisting with outbound logistics Requirements:

Previous customer service experience An understanding of the importance of delighting the customer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al A problem solver Able to work efficiently through high volume work Passion for learning more about the drinks industry, in particular craft producers Self-motivated, enthusiastic, and able to work well as part of a small team in a busy environment Benefits:

Central London location Real career progression opportunities, with the chance to grow as we do Dynamic working environment in our small and dedicated team Regular social events Flexible working hours Weekly gin tasting opportunities Generous staff discount on our online store At Craft Gin Club we value diversity and welcome applicants from all backgrounds. We look for team members who will positively contribute to our gin-loving, passionate culture and believe that an inclusive and diverse work environment is one in which we all thrive.
